The Human Voice May Not Spark Pleasure In Children With Autism : Shots - Health News : NPR - 1 views

  •  
    "The human voice appears to trigger pleasure circuits in the brains of typical kids, but not children with autism, a Stanford University team reports. The finding could explain why many children with autism seem indifferent to spoken words."

Institute on Disabilities at Temple University, Pennsylvania's UCEDD - University Cente... - 1 views

  •  
    "Individuals who use augmentative and alternative communication (AAC) and their families have new expectations for life after high school, including attending college, becoming employed, managing personal assistance services and transportation, and having intimate relations. However, the vocabulary needed to support these socially-valued adult roles is frequently not be available in pre-programmed devices nor in commonly used visual symbol systems. This website contains vocabulary needed to participate in 8 socially-valued adult roles: * College Life * Emergency Preparedness * Employment * Sexuality, Intimacy, and Sex * Reporting Crime and Abuse * Managing Personal Assistance Services * Managing Health Care, and * Using Transportation "

Communication Matrix - 2 views

  •  
    "The Communication Matrix is an assessment tool designed to pinpoint exactly how an individual is communicating and to provide a framework for determining logical communication goals. It was first published in 1990 and was revised in 1996 and 2004 by Dr. Charity Rowland of Oregon Health & Science University. It was designed primarily for speech-language pathologists and educators to use to document the expressive communication skills of children who have severe or multiple disabilities, including children with sensory, motor and cognitive impairments."

OpenStax CNX - Universal Design for Access and Equity - 0 views

  •  
    "Institutions of higher education are experiencing major shifts in pedagogy with teaching approaches that focus on student centered learning and increased access for learners who face challenges due to social, economic and cultural pressures. The traditional lecture based, face-to-face classroom is not as viable in light of information technology and learning tools offered by online instruction. More learners are participating in expanded learning communities unrestricted by geographical location and time restraints with more flexible access to content anytime and anywhere. The demographic composition of the college student population is shifting in response to economic, social, educational, health and political changes in the United States. In addition to students with disabilities, English language learners, and ethnic and racial minorities, other forms of diversity need to be considered in the classroom including gender, class, age, employment status, race and culture and family and work related responsibilities. Meeting the needs of these students is critical to insuring they have equitable access and opportunities to participate in higher education"

Visiting the Model Classrooms - Department of Allied Health Sciences - UNC School of Me... - 1 views

  •  
    Karen Erickson's observation forms for visiting their model classrooms. "# Read about some of the key activities that will be observed in the classrooms: * Shared Reading * Self-Selected Reading * Self-Selected Writing # Download the three guided observation forms for the above activities. Visitors will need to bring these forms to the visit. Visitors will use these forms to guide their observation of shared reading, self-selected reading and self-selected writing. The forms are organized by the key components and steps of the lessons with places to take notes, as well as places to jot down questions for the teacher. In order to make the time as productive as possible, these completed forms will be used to structure the discussion with the teacher /after/ the lesson. When the school visit is over, the observation forms can be a valuable lesson planner for visitors who want to implement these activities in their own classrooms. * Shared Reading Guided Observation Form * Self-Selected Reading Guided Observation Form * Self-Selected Writing Guided Observation Form"
